Flashing red light engine temperature gauge for a Porsche 996?

Coolant Level too low (or sensor went bad) or Engine Compartment Temp too high / engine compartment fan failure

Why does your radiator fan stay on in your 1990 Celica?

If your air conditioner is on, the fan(s) will most often run steady. If the AC is off (or you have none), it could be that you engine is running too hot for various reasons. What does the temp guage say? As well, it could be a faulty fan relay switch.. or faulty fan switch sensor in the radiator.. or a faulty temp sensor on the engine. Lots of possibilities.

What temp should cooling fan come on 98 Chevy venture 3.4?

The engine computer (PCM) operates the fans by opening and closing the ground for the fans. The PCM will command the low speed fan to come on when coolant temp exceeds 221 degrees.The fan should always come on whenever you turn on the A/C no matter the engine temperature.The fan will also operate with the engine off when the engine coolant temp is over 140 degrees.The PCM will ground all 3 engine coolant fan relays when the coolant temp is 235 degrees or the A/C pressure is too high and run the fans on high speed.


Why does the radiator fan turn too fast on my Honda Passport?

The electric fans are controlled by a computer. The fan speed is set by engine temp, A/C being on and ambient air temperature. High fan speed is needed if the A/C is on or the engine is hot. If you're concerned get the cooling system checked out, you may have a clogged radiator core.
